Here's the easy way how.
1. Open two instances of BrawlBox
2. Open the SSE stage you want to play on in one.
3. Open a Brawl Stage you want to replace in the other.(I normally use Wifi Waiting Room)
4. Export the following files from the SSE Stage. ModelData[0], ModelData[100],TextureData[0], SceneData[0], ef_*.pac,Type1[2], Type1[10]
5. Replace the related files with the ones from the SSE stage.
6. Make sure all .pacs are compressed the same way they were originally. effect .pacs in adventure stages aren't compressed, but they are in stages.
7. Save file on your SD card.
